Global superstar JENNIE has released her latest single, “Less than a Lover,” alongside its accompanying music video through ODDATELIER and Columbia Records, showcasing a softer, more introspective side of her artistry.

Described as an ode to summer, the track captures the uncertainty and excitement of a relationship that exists somewhere between friendship and romance. Written by JENNIE herself, “Less than a Lover” reflects on the emotions that arise from an undefined connection, blending alternative-pop influences with lo-fi guitar textures, vintage electric keyboards, and understated production that highlights her expressive vocals and lyricism.
The accompanying music video, based on a story conceived by JENNIE, follows the singer as she steps into an imagined world while filming a short movie with friends. As the fictional love story unfolds, the experience gradually alters the dynamics between the characters, mirroring the song’s exploration of relationships that resist clear definitions.
JENNIE first introduced “Less than a Lover” during her headline performance at Governors Ball in June before bringing the track to audiences at major international festivals, including Mad Cool, Open’er, and Roskilde. She is set to continue her global festival run as a headliner at Lollapalooza Chicago before making her debut appearance at Summer Sonic Festival in Japan.
